Two bombs were discovered at Manila's airport and at Subic Bay Freeport, where 18 Pacific Rim leaders will gather next Monday for a Asia-Pacific Economic Co-operation summit, magnifying security concerns for the meeting.
One bomb was found in a bag in the arrival area of the Ninoy Aquino International Airport, officials said. A bomb squad prepared to explode it outside the terminal. Another was found in the afternoon by a janitor in a crowded area near the main gate of Subic Bay Freeport, the former US naval base west of Manila.Security officials defused that bomb. AP - Manila
